upsTrapAlarmEntryRemoved
Module: UPS-MIB
OID (symbolic): UPS-MIB::upsTrapAlarmEntryRemoved
O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.2.1.33.2.4
Node type: NOTIFICATION-TYPE
Description: This trap is sent each time an alarm is removed from the alarm table. It is sent on the removal of all alarms except for upsAlarmTestInProgress.
Examples
Send this trap to an SNMP manager — replace <manager> with the IP or hostname of your monitoring server (SNMPv2c):
snmptrap -v2c -c public <manager> '' UPS-MIB::upsTrapAlarmEntryRemoved snmptrap -v2c -c public <manager> '' 1.3.6.1.2.1.33.2.4
Listen for incoming traps on the manager host (-f keeps it in the foreground, -Lo prints to stdout — useful for testing):
snmptrapd -f -Lo -c /dev/null authCommunity log public
Example snmptrapd log entry:
zoo11-linux.zoo [UDP: [192.168.30.111]:61382->[192.168.30.10]:162]: DISMAN-EVENT-MIB::sysUpTimeInstance = Timeticks: (440527814) 50 days, 23:41:18.14 SNMPv2-MIB::snmpTrapOID.0 = OID: UPS-MIB::upsTrapAlarmEntryRemoved
